  • Cathedral of Santa Maria del FioreOpens in a new window – Stand in awe of the Cathedral of Santa Maria del Fiore, an architectural marvel with its stunning dome designed by Brunelleschi. Climb to the top for a breathtaking view of Florence's skyline and get lost in the beautiful frescoes that adorn the interior. This iconic cathedral is not just a religious site; it’s a symbol of Florence's rich history and artistry.

Best time to go to Florence (FLR-Peretola)

Florence (FLR-Peretola) exper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 41.4°F (5.2°C), while July to August are the hottest months, with an average temperature of 75.2°F (24.0°C). November is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ere at Florence (FLR-Peretola), April, July, and September are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is sunny to mostly sunny, with little to no r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, October to December are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.

Where is Florence Airport, Peretola (FLR)?

The airport is located 3.5 mi (5.7 km) from Florence city center. If you're looking for things to see and do in the area, you might like to visit Cathedral of Santa Maria del Fiore and Uffizi Gallery.
